If my flight lands at MCO at 9:00 what time do you think I'll be at WDW? I figure the ME will take me to the resort (POFQ) first and then I'm on to Epcot. Will I be at Epcot by 11:00, 12:00?
 
Well, it's about 25min between MCO and WDW. That being said, you still have to get through ME and resort check-in.

I would say that 12 is a safer bet. Though if everything goes smoothly, you could be on a bus headed to Epcot by 11.

Agree with all of the above. However, would like to add that depending on crowds and numbers of buses running, ME can take up to a half hour or so (maybe more) before you're even on the bus. Or it can take 5 minutes. Then, it also depends on whether or not your hotel is the first stop. Usually there's about 3-4 hotels per ME bus, and about 10-15 minutes per hotel (then 5-10 minutes or so driving between, give or take). So you're travel time getting off the plane to getting to your hotel can be anywhere from an hour to about an hour and a half/two. Then check in can take up to a half hour in waiting then actual checking in. Then you have to wait for the bus (up to 20 minutes), then its about a 10 minute ride to Epcot. When we go, we like to aim for three hours before making any definite plans, but it's possible you'll make it by 12. I'd aim for closer to 1 though.

Sorry if this is confusing, but we've done this a few times, and the timing with ME is so up in the air, that it really is anyone's guess as to when you'll actually be getting to your resort.
